Gameplay
StarDunk is a hooptastic Android app that pits you in a global scoring battle. I’m a big fan of retro-style action, and StarDunk is definitely reminiscent of games such as Space Jam and, yes, your favorite arcade basketball shooting game.

The concept is simple: working from the location that the game places your ball, work the angle to sink shot after shot. You can use the handy backboard to make bank shots, but you get more a bonus for points that are nothing but net. Boosts and special triple shots help make the game more interesting. The real fun comes from Open Feint interaction.
I am always leery of giving Open Feint the credit that is really due to a stellar app. StarDunk may be one exception. If you are going to play StarDunk, log in to Open Feint. Using Open Feint you can play against other users worldwide online, opening up a whole new bag of tricks in this app. Participate in contests and earn points to open up new game features along the way.
Customization
There are a lot of customization options in StarDunk including different backgrounds, custom balls, volume and sound effect control, and even bonuses that can up your in-app game like a pair of Air Jordans upped your game back in middle school.

User Interface

The majority of StarDunk Android app game control is all about the drag and drop. Pull the ball trajectory around the screen to make your shots. The app is extremely responsive and I didn’t have a single issue with the user interface. Pause buttons and point indicators are kept small and unobtrusive giving you optimal game play space.
Customization and menu navigation is equally easy. Your Android’s back button and an on screen back button functions as a main navigation tool.
Value
StarDunk Android app is free to download. I love free! But I hate feeling sucked in to making in app purchases. Sure, you can play the game for hours to earn enough points to upgrade to the first set of new ball patterns and backgrounds, but some of this stuff is seriously cool and I don’t have weeks of free time lying around to spend earning it. Maybe I just didn’t feel like being teased today, but I would have rather spent a little dough up front on this app than be pushed into making impulse purchases while I play.

Android Apps Review Details: The StarDunk Android app is free. This app requires Android 2.1 and up. You may download StarDunk from the Android Market.
